The technology of some repeaters in wireless is "store and forward" which introduce a delay from th einput to the output.
Your current setup is such that if the repeaters introduce a delay, the delay is common for all devices, whether a device is on link A or link B
Your proposed solution has the first set of devices 1-16 seeing direct comm with the master, but the 2nd set of slavex, 17-32 seeing whatever delay the repeater might introduce.
If your protocol is time sensitive, a delay might screw things up for response from 17-32 (as in Modbus RTU)
